Understanding Common Rodent Entry Points
Mice and rats can squeeze through surprisingly small openings to access your home. Mice can fit through holes as small as a dime, while rats require openings roughly the size of a quarter. Common entry points include gaps around doors and windows, cracks in foundations, openings around utility lines, and damaged roof vents. Effective mice and rat control begins with identifying and sealing these potential access routes using steel wool, caulk, or hardware cloth.
Essential Prevention Strategies for Rat Control
For rat control to be successful, their food sources and shelter opportunities must be eliminated. Store all food items in sealed containers made of glass or metal, as rodents can easily chew through cardboard and plastic packaging. Clean up crumbs and spills immediately, and avoid leaving pet food out overnight. Remove clutter from basements, attics, and storage areas where rodents might nest. Trim tree branches away from your roof line, as these provide convenient highways for rats to access your home.
Maintaining Your Property to Deter Rodents
Regular property maintenance plays an important role in mice control and rat control efforts. Keep grass cut short and remove overgrown vegetation near your home's foundation. Repair any damaged screens on windows and vents, and ensure that door sweeps create proper seals. Address any moisture problems quickly, as rodents need water sources to survive. Fix leaky pipes, improve ventilation in humid areas, and ensure proper drainage around your property.
When to Contact Professional Rodent Control Services
While prevention measures are important, rodent infestations typically require professional intervention. Signs that it’s time for professional mice control or rat control services include discovering droppings, hearing scratching sounds in walls or ceilings, finding chewed materials, or noticing grease marks along baseboards and walls.
